(noun.) an island in the Indian Ocean off the southeastern coast of Africa; the 4th largest island in the world.
(noun.) a republic on the island of Madagascar; achieved independence from France in 1960.
亚伯整理
双语例句
But first they resolved to sell the goods the ship, and then go to Madagascar for recruits, several among them having died since my confinement. 乔纳森·斯威夫特.格列佛游记.
But they haven't got any of the Madagascar Liquid. 查尔斯·狄更斯.大卫·科波菲尔.
When you are at Madagascar, or at the Cape, or in India, would it be a consolation to have that memento in your possession? 夏洛蒂·勃朗特.简·爱.